Course Details

• Advanced Digital Ethnography: This unit will cover the use of digital tools and platforms to conduct ethnographic research in the modern world.
• Digital Anthropology Theory: An in-depth exploration of the theories and concepts that underpin the field of digital anthropology.
• Cyberanthropology: This unit will examine the anthropological study of online communities and cultures, including virtual worlds and social media.
• Data Analysis for Digital Anthropology: Students will learn how to analyze and interpret data collected from digital sources, including online surveys and social media platforms.
• Digital Heritage and Material Culture: This unit will cover the preservation and study of digital heritage, including the impact of digital technology on material culture.
• Digital Activism and Social Justice: This unit will examine the role of digital technology in social movements and activism, with a focus on the intersection of anthropology and social justice.
• Mobile Technologies and Anthropology: This unit will cover the impact of mobile devices on cultural practices and social interactions, and the use of mobile technology in anthropological research.
• Digital Inequality: This unit will explore the issues of digital divide and inequality, and the impact of these issues on marginalized communities.
• Digital Ethics in Anthropology: This unit will cover the ethical considerations and challenges of conducting research in the digital age, including issues of privacy, consent, and representation.
